Latest Patents

Mimura's latest patents include a method for producing artificial leather sheets. This innovative method involves coating a solution containing an elastic polymer on a substrate layer, which consists of ultra-fine fibers and another elastic polymer. The process includes pressing the sheet's surface with an emboss roll to create hills and coating the top portions with a solution of a different elastic polymer. Another significant patent is for a skin material for balls, which features a base layer and a multi-layered coating made of polymeric elastomers. This material is designed to enhance wet gripping, wear resistance, and impact absorption, making it ideal for ball games.
